Consider the Constitution is a podcast from the Robert H. Smith Center for the Constitution at James Madison's Montpelier. The show provides insight into constitutional issues that directly affect every American. Hosted by Dr. Katie Crawford Lackey the podcast features interviews with constitutional scholars, policy and subject matter experts, heritage professionals, and legal practitioners.

"Four Years of Heat" is an 8-episode limited series narrative podcast written and hosted by South Florida native, Israel Gutierrez. The show dives deep into the behind-the-scenes story of what happened during the four years LeBron James spent with Dwyane Wade, Chris Bosh and the Miami Heat. It chronicles the inside stories of “The Decision,” the loss to the Mavericks in the 2011 Finals, the back-to-back titles in 2012-13, and LeBron’s choice to go “Home” to Cleveland in 2014.
